Transaction 81eb5bd8096e9fc95792a37307d6e09f7203bfb854c3ce9ec35515d03ded061c
1 Input
1 Output
-
81eb5bd8096e9fc95792a37307d6e09f7203bfb854c3ce9ec35515d03ded061c:0
- value
- 146853
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9b27ad0ef4eb0325efa4e9a4d044ff6039fb906 OP_EQUAL
- address
- 3MY6NAKJafNBZrQnhyCRnTy1mTnx2dQxaV